Metis Global Partners LLC trimmed its position in Principal Financial Group, Inc. (NYSE:PFG - Free Report) by 34.4%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 7,366 shares of the company's stock after selling 3,864 shares during the quarter. Metis Global Partners LLC's holdings in Principal Financial Group were worth $570,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Principal Financial Group Increases Dividend
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, March 28th. Investors of record on Wednesday, March 12th will be paid a $0.75 dividend. This is an increase from Principal Financial Group's previous quarterly dividend of $0.73.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, March 12th. This represents a $3.00 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.50%. Principal Financial Group's dividend payout ratio is presently 44.91%.

Principal Financial Group, Inc provides retirement, asset management, and insurance products and services to businesses, individuals, and institutional clients worldwide. The company operates through Retirement and Income Solutions, Principal Asset Management, and Benefits and Protection segments. The Retirement and Income Solutions segment provides retirement, and related financial products and services.
